War Crimes: U.S. Priorities and Military Force: A Report of the National Inquiry Group

New York, NY: The National Council of Churches, 1972. Presumed first edition/first printing. Wraps. 48 p. Occasional footnotes. Among the other members of the National Inquiry Group were: Allan Parrent; Richard J. Barnet; Ernest Gross, and Patrick P. McDrmott, S. J. The Inquiry Group attempted to ferret out some of the reasons for conduct they considered war crimes and to discover the connections, if any, between this behavior and the public policies of the government of the United States.
